eligible for eTA expansion - CORRECT ANSWER: Foreign nationals who are eligible for
eTA expansion receive a TRV upon the issuance of their initial study permit. If these
clients are issued a renewed study permit, they are automatically issued an eTA.
However, these foreign nationals still require a TRV to travel by any mode of
transportation other than air.
Note: While a study permit is not required for short-term courses, officers must accept
and process an application for a study permit, even when the duration of the course or
program of study is 6 months or less [R188(2)].
For eTA-required foreign nationals - CORRECT ANSWER: For eTA-required foreign
nationals, the eTA is valid for 5 years from the date of issuance or until the foreign
national's passport expires, whichever occurs first, regardless of whether or not this
date is after the expiry date of the study permit.
Graduates of vocational and professional training programs in Quebec - CORRECT
ANSWER: To be eligible for a PGWP, the student must graduate from a recognized
secondary institution in Quebec with one of the following diplomas:
a diploma of vocational studies (DVS)
an attestation of vocational specialization (AVS)
In Quebec, vocational and professional training programs can be delivered at the
secondary or post-secondary level.

Keep original Study permit status - CORRECT ANSWER: In the following situations,
students do not need to apply for a new SP:
#Transition between levels of study (primary, secondary and post-secondary)
#Dual-credit programs
#Changing post-secondary institutions
Minor child coming to Canada - CORRECT ANSWER: A minor child coming to study in
Canada will need to have a custodian in Canada. The duration of a SP issued to a
minor is usually one year. But if the child is accompanying parents who have been
issued a long-term SP or WP, then minor child would have the same duration as
parent's.

, Open Work Permit for Spouse - CORRECT ANSWER: Your spouse or common-law
partner may be eligible for an open work permit if you:
# have a valid study permit and
# are a full-time student at one of these types of schools:
#a public post-secondary school, such as a college or university, or CEGEP in Quebec
#private college-level school in Quebec
# a Canadian private school that can legally award degrees under provincial law (for
example, Bachelors, Masters or Doctorate degree)
PGWP Leave from studies-1/2 - CORRECT ANSWER: If the applicant remained in
Canada while a student and took leave from their studies during their program, the
officer must determine if the applicant was compliant with the conditions of their study
permit, as outlined in Assessing study permit conditions.
Officers may request additional documents to complete their assessment. Per
paragraph R220.1(1)(b), students must
#be enrolled at a DLI
#remain enrolled
#be actively pursuing their course or program of study
PGWP Leave from studies-2/2 - CORRECT ANSWER: If the officer determines that the
student actively pursued studies during their leave, the student may still be eligible for
the PGWP Program.
If it is determined that the student has not met the conditions of their study permit, they
may be banned from applying for a PGWP for 6 months from the date they stopped
their unauthorized study or work, per subparagraph R200(3)(e)(i).
PGWP Part-time status for final academic session - CORRECT ANSWER: Students
must maintain their full-time student status during each academic session of the
program or programs of study they complete and submit as part of their post-graduation
work permit application.
